Sue Pelland Designs

Specializing in rotary cut appliqué

Empty

Total: $0.00

Can't print shipping label from PayPal

Type: 
Bug Report
Priority: 
Critical
Section: 
Shop
Status: 
Closed: Fixed/Done

PayPal transactions from the old ecommerce website (which also used PayPal standard), allow you to create a shipping label from within PayPal. This is part of the current workflow for SPD staff when fulfilling orders. Orders created from the new website do not allow you to print the label (because there is no shipping address associated with them). Search Drupal Commerce PayPal module issue queues or other forums to see if anyone else has reported this and if there is a way to make it do so. Perhaps one of the other PayPal payment methods would work?

Comments

By Maria Greene on

Applied patch from #4 here:

https://www.drupal.org/node/1494586

But now getting this error on the checkout page which redirects to PayPal:

Notice: Undefined index: no_shipping in commerce_paypal_wps_order_form() (line 457 of /home/ruby/public_html/spd/profiles/commerce_kickstart/modules/contrib/commerce_paypal/modules/wps/commerce_paypal_wps.module).

By Maria Greene on

This error message went away once I edited and saved (without modifying) the PayPal WPS payment method rule. The PayPal site no longer says the seller is not covered by seller protection, but the print shipping label still does not work.

By Maria Greene on

Changing the PayPal WPS configuration setting that was added by the patch fixed the problem. Shipping addresses are now sent to PayPal and printing shipping labels works fine.

Add new comment